Legacy On Park Avenue - 20416 Park Avenue, Langley, BC V3A 4N3, Canada. Crossroads are 204 Street and Park Avenue located in Langley. The development is scheduled for completion in 2020. Legacy On Park Avenue has a total of 69 units. Legacy On Park Avenue is a new condo developed by MDM Construction.

1 851 Broughton – 2 new Towers are proposed

The Christ Church Cathedral precinct on the edge of downtown Victoria could be significantly transformed if Concert Properties gets rezoning approval for a two-tower housing project that would bring 370 new homes to what once was a YMCA-YWCA facility.

The Vancouver developer has made an application to rezone 851 Broughton St. to allow for a mixed-use project that will include 26- and 11-storey towers housing 220 condominiums and 150 rental units, respectively.

4 Big data drives operating efficiencies as properties automate controls

Arthur Erickson Place is echoing the trees through a low carbon footprint that recently saw it designated a Zero Carbon Building by the Canada Green Building Council, which also administers the long-standing LEED (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design) program.

A three-year decarbonization process that began in 2022 and completes in 2025 will reduce energy use by 40 per cent and cut carbon emissions by 97 per cent, or 600 tonnes annually.

5 Condo purchasers owned multiple units: lawsuit

Civil suits filed by B.C. Housing allege 13 of the units at Vivid at the Yates on Johnson Street went to people who already owned property, or who rented out their units instead of living in them.

One of the purchasers of a unit in a downtown building subsidized for first-time homebuyers already owned six single-family homes in the Victoria area worth more than $7 million, says a civil suit filed by B.C. Housing.

It’s one of several lawsuits filed by B.C. Housing against 13 people who bought condos in Vivid at the Yates at 845 Johnson St.
